Hi after findind the sorce of my aircon probs,which were not under the dash as we found out latter after ripping it out, i went for a drive , then silence no audio, no power to radio !, well i look at fuses ,all o'k', swap em anyhow,still no power !, now im lost cos one fused shared is with door locks and they are fine and the singular 7.5 fuse was o'k' but still changed. Is there an inline fuse somewhere ?, its an aftermarket Kenwood system put in by previous owner, cheers.

Hi found out the prob , was not a fuse but the head unit fitting only loosely on the body,quick fix ! .
